    Learn to play G Major, D Major and A major Scales from the Open Strings. In this tutorial, Catherine shows you how you can easily learn all 3 of these One Octave Scales as well as their matching Arpeggios. This clear and simple tutorial is perfect for beginner violin students. This is also great for violin teachers seeking new and interesting ways to teach scales on the violin. In this video, you will learn how to play the G, D and A major scales from the open strings using the M hand shape or finger pattern, where the middle 2 fingers - the second and third fingers - are together. Using this hand pattern makes it very easy to transpose your scales from one string to the next!

    Hi sometimes when i play the scales my fingers tend to move into positions which are slightly higher or lower than the required position . i dont realise this and i practice it in that way thereby repeating the incorrect position over time . how do i correct this . i prefer not to use any finger note stickers .

    • @violinwithcatherine
      @violinwithcatherine  ปีที่แล้ว +1

      Hi! That’s a great question! This IS one of the big challenges of violin - playing IN TUNE. That’s great you’re not using stickers, because that tends to focus on LOOKING for the correct position, when the only real way of knowing if the fingers are in the correct place is by LISTENING. I suggest developing your Aural skills concurrently with your playing skills. Practice singing the notes. Really LISTEN to the pitch when you play. It takes time also to develop the aural skills required for violin playing 👂🏼🎶🎻

    I have one doubt in D major scale--
    We could have also played A as open but you played A on D.
    Is there any specific rule to it in higher grades? Or its always a choice.
    Pls explain

    • @violinwithcatherine
      @violinwithcatherine  17 วันที่ผ่านมา +2

      It's a choice. I always teach students to use 4th in scales because it is an opportunity to train the 4th finger. In pieces, we will do which one suits better (yes, sometimes 4th is better than the open string) :D
